We review the properties of supersymmetric quantum mechanics for a class of models proposed by Witten. Some recently given examples of accidental degeneracies are shown to arise from an underlying supersymmetry. The appropriate dynamical supersymmetries are identified. The relevant spectrum-generating superalgebras for these supersymmetric quantum-mechamcal systems are introduced and studied.
